The era of the 54-hole format in LIV Golf is over now. Maybe now, it will unlock OWRG access, and LIV golfers will get an equal platform to rank themselves? Many remain hazy about it; one of them is Carlos Ortiz. As he puts it, there’s hope, but also a lingering skepticism.
“I mean, honestly, at this point, we’ve been saying that for the last four years. I honestly don’t care, you know?” he said without any scope of diplomacy. “For me, if I get into the Majors, that’s the important thing. I mean, if we can get OWGR to help with that, it would be great. But if not…I don’t think really anybody cares. I think saying that you’re whatever rank in the world is more of an ego thing,” Ortiz told Flushing It.
